Used BMW X3 cars for sale near Northallerton, North Yorkshire

Loading...
Make (any)
Model (any)
Min price (any)
Max price (any)

BMW, X32021 (21) xDrive20i M Sport 5dr Step Auto Petrol Estate 

45
Low Mileage
£32,379
  • 2L
  • 26.1kMiles
  • Petrol
  • Auto
  • Body StyleSUV

Vertu BMW Teesside

BMW, X32012 (12) xDrive20d SE 5dr Step Auto 

43
£4,995
Finance available £89 pm
  • 2L
  • 177.4k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Trunk Road Budget Cars

BMW, X32019 (19) 2.0 20d M Sport Auto xDrive Euro 6 (s/s) 5dr 

29
£21,495
Finance available £421 pm
  • 2L
  • 81.4k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Tamebridge Cars Ltd

BMW, X32021 (21) xDrive30d MHT M Sport 5dr Auto Diesel Estate 

57
£34,225
  • 3L
  • 49.8k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Vertu BMW Teesside

BMW, X32012 3.0 X3 xDrive30d M Sport 5-Door 

51
Reduced
£9,995
  • 3L
  • 96.5k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Woodcroft Motors

BMW, X32023 (72) XDRIVE20D 2.0 M SPORT MHEV 5-Door 

37
Reduced
£42,995
Finance available £862 pm
  • 2L
  • 11kMiles
  • Hybrid
  • Auto
  • Body StyleSUV

Bespoke Motor Works Ltd

01642 937532 *
5/5 Stars

BMW, X32019 xDrive20d M Sport 5dr Step Auto 

40
Low Mileage
£27,999
Finance available £579 pm
  • 2L
  • 18.5k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Motorpoint Stockton-On-Tees

BMW, X32021 xDrive 30e SE 5dr Auto 

43
£26,099
Finance available £538 pm
  • 2L
  • 38.7kMiles
  • Hybrid
  • Auto
  • Body StyleSUV

Motorpoint Stockton-On-Tees

BMW, X32016 (65) 2.0 20d M Sport Suv 2 5-Door 

17
£12,695
Finance available £261 pm
  • 2L
  • 86.8kMiles
  • Diesel
  • Auto
  • Body StyleSUV

Donaldsons Auto Centre Limited

BMW, X32023 (73) xDrive 30e M Sport 5dr Auto Estate 

56
£45,174
  • 2L
  • 10.1kMiles
  • Hybrid
  • Auto
  • Body StyleSUV

Vertu BMW Teesside